The value of the limit `("lim")_(xvec0)(a^(sqrt(x))-a^(1 / sqrt(x)))/(a^(sqrt(x))+a^(1 / sqrt(x))),a >1,i s` 4 (b) 2 (c) `-1` (d) 0

A

does not exist

B

`1//3`

C

0

D

`2//9`

Text Solution

Verified by Experts

The correct Answer is:
C

`underset(xto0)lim(a^(sqrt(x))-a^(1//sqrt(x)))/(a^(sqrt(x))+a^(1//sqrt(x))),agt1`
Put `x=r^(2)."Then"`
`underset(t to0)lim(a^(t)-a^(1//t))/(a^(t)+a^(1//t))`
or`underset(t to0)lim(a^(t-1//t)-1)/(a^(t-1//t)+1)=(a^(-oo)-1)/(a^(-oo)+1)=-1`
